Again, I'm not aware of any credible scientific basis for the position that consciousness is some sort of a field which is a product of quantum processes. The most plausible explanation is that it is encoded in the pattern of electrochemical firings of neurons.

Consciousness itself may just be nothing more than an exhaust fume resulting from the functioning of the brain rather than something profound to be explained. It may simply be a phenomenon of the system observing patterns within the world and modelling itself in the process as part of the simulation it is creating. This is basically the HOT view of consciousness, and it's really the only theory that at lest provides some explanatory power for the origin of the phenomenon.
